MGM will require unvaccinated workers to pay for COVID testing

Culinary Local 226 said it is supportive of the company’s policy and encouraged people to get the vaccine. The union represents about 24,000 MGM workers in Las Vegas, including those at Aria, Bellagio, Excalibur, Luxor, MGM Grand, Mandalay Bay, New York-New York, Park MGM, Signature and Vdara.

“The CDC said previously that more than 97 percent of people who have been admitted to the hospital with COVID-19 have not been vaccinated. The Culinary Union urges Nevadans who are not yet vaccinated to get the vaccine — it is the best way to protect you, your family, our hospitality jobs, and our state’s industries,” union spokeswoman Bethany Khan said. “The Culinary union will remain vigilant to ensure workers are protected at work and urge hospitality employees to get the COVID-19 vaccine as they are safe, proven, and effective."
